Lee & Karen Wood

Lee & Karen Wood

In 1992 Lee and Karen joined Wycliffe to help bring God’s Word to those who do not have it in their own language. God called them and their children to Papua New Guinea in 1993 where over 830 languages are spoken and more than 280 of these languages are still without Scripture. Lee worked as a missionary aircraft mechanic and Karen served as a nurse for the next 22 years. In 2014 God changed their direction and they are now serving Wycliffe here in the United States. Lee is working an outside job to supplement their income while Karen serves full-time with Wycliffe in the Member Care department. Having had 25 years of experience as missionaries themselves, it is their prayer that God uses her to provide guidance, support and care to the missionaries assigned to her who face many unique challenges working cross-culturally around the world.

Wycliffe Ministry Budget

Wycliffe establishes a Ministry Budget for its members to reflect recurring expenses related to family factors and their geographic location of service. Giving to Wycliffe directly impacts members' ability to begin and remain in their assignment.

This monthly budget covers ministry-related expenses, insurance and retirement, social security and taxes, and Wycliffe administrative costs. The remainder is what the members receive as "take-home pay" for their daily living expenses.
